如何在Oracle中查看行动迁移

2025-01-14 19:02:13   小编

如何在Oracle中查看行动迁移

在Oracle数据库管理过程中,查看行动迁移是一项关键操作,它有助于数据库管理员深入了解数据的动态变化以及系统的运行状况。以下将详细介绍在Oracle中查看行动迁移的方法。

要利用Oracle自带的视图。DBA_MOVING_TABLES视图是一个重要的信息源。通过查询该视图,能够获取关于正在进行或已经完成的行动迁移相关信息。例如,可以通过编写SQL语句:

SELECT * FROM DBA_MOVING_TABLES;

这条简单的语句可以返回一系列关键数据,如迁移任务的ID、涉及的表名、迁移状态等。如果只想获取特定表的迁移信息,可以在查询语句中添加WHERE子句进行筛选:

SELECT * FROM DBA_MOVING_TABLES WHERE TABLE_NAME = 'YOUR_TABLE_NAME';

除了查看迁移任务的基本信息,了解迁移的进度也至关重要。V$RMAN_STATUS视图在此发挥作用。该视图提供了备份、恢复以及迁移操作的实时状态信息。

SELECT * FROM V$RMAN_STATUS WHERE OPERATION = 'MOVE';

这条语句可以展示行动迁移操作的详细状态,包括操作开始时间、当前执行步骤、是否遇到错误等信息。通过持续监控这个视图,管理员可以及时发现潜在的问题并采取相应措施。

另外,日志文件也是查看行动迁移的重要途径。Oracle数据库的警报日志(alert log)记录了系统中发生的重要事件,包括行动迁移相关的信息。在警报日志中,可以找到关于迁移任务的启动、结束以及过程中出现的任何重要消息。通常,警报日志文件存储在特定的目录下,其位置可以通过查询参数文件(parameter file)来确定。

在查看行动迁移时,还可以利用企业管理器(Oracle Enterprise Manager)。通过图形化界面,管理员可以直观地查看迁移任务的状态、进度条以及相关的统计信息。这种可视化方式大大简化了查看和分析行动迁移的过程,尤其适合不熟悉复杂SQL操作的用户。

通过合理运用这些方法,无论是利用SQL查询视图、查看日志文件还是借助企业管理器,都能全面、准确地在Oracle中查看行动迁移,为数据库的稳定运行和有效管理提供有力支持。

TAGS: Oracle技术 Oracle数据库 Oracle行动迁移查看 行动迁移

欢迎使用万千站长工具!

Welcome to www.zzTool.com